In the second round of the French Open on Wednesday, Iga Swiatek narrowly defeated Naomi Osaka 7-6 (7-1) 1-6 7-5 after surviving match point.

After leading the defending champion and the world No. 1 in the third set, Osaka appeared to be about to pull off her biggest victory in a long time. After trailing match point down to Osaka, Swiatek claimed she would have had to be quite ignorant to believe she could overcome her before rallying to win a thrilling French Open match.

Swiatek expressed her thoughts about it after the match and said: I honestly didn’t believe I could win, because I would be pretty naive. But it didn’t change the fact that I just tried to do work to play better. I managed to be more focused at the end of the match, which went pretty badly. In the first and second sets, I felt like I was not completely in the zone. When I was under the biggest pressure, I was able to switch that and maybe that made the difference.”

Swiatek was emotional and cried after the game after saving the match point in a fierce battle with Osaka. She seemed surprised after pulling off an exciting victory at the French Open.

Currently ranked no.1, Iga achieved a 40-4 match record in 2024. Iga is now competing at the French Open where she bested the world no.148 Leolia Jeanjean 6-1 6-2 and the world no.134 Naomi Osaka 7-61 1-6 7-5.

Iga Swiatek will play the world no.42 Marie Bouzkova in the 3rd round. They have never competed against each other so far on the main tour.

Swiatek has won 5 titles in 2024 in Australia, Doha, Indian Wells, Madrid and Rome.

Iga won 22 titles in her career: 13 on hard courts and 9 on clay courts. (See the list of her titles)

Iga Swiatek and Naomi Osaka squared off 3 times. Their current record is 2-1 for Swiatek. Previously, the last time they competed against each other, Iga Swiatek won 7-6(1) 1-6 7-5 in the 2nd round in Paris (French Open) on the 29th of May 2024.
